A porcine islet-encapsulation device that enables long-term discordant xenotransplantation in immunocompetent diabetic mice
Islet transplantation is an effective treatment for type 1 diabetes (T1D). However, a shortage of donors and the need for immunosuppressants are major issues. The ideal solution is to develop a source of insulin-secreting cells and an immunoprotective method. No bioartificial pancreas (BAP) devices...
